    Clementine, Tomahawk, and Amarok do all of these things as well. I personally recommend Clementine.

    If you have music files that are not well named there is MusicBrains Picard. It can do renaming, lookup based on tags, lookup based on filename, and it can do lookup based on fingerprint matching, which is far more accurate than you would expect. After you have the correct information it will save the file in the directory you specify, with the naming convention that you specify, and saves all the tag information including artwork.
